Language-learning software tools such as Duolingo and Rosetta Stone are digital platforms designed to facilitate language acquisition through interactive lessons, exercises, and multimedia content. They cater to a wide range of languages and skill levels, providing users with accessible, flexible, and engaging ways to learn new languages at their own pace.
Key Features
- Interactive lessons incorporating listening, speaking, reading, and writing exercises
- Gamification elements to boost motivation and engagement
- Progress tracking and personalized learning paths
- Availability across multiple devices, including smartphones and desktops
- Speech recognition technology for pronunciation practice
- Offline access for certain content
- Community features such as forums or social sharing
Pros
- Highly accessible and user-friendly interface
- Flexible learning schedule suited for busy lifestyles
- Engaging game-like elements that motivate continued use
- Wide variety of languages available
- Effective for foundational vocabulary and basic grammar
Cons
- May lack depth needed for advanced proficiency
- Some features require a subscription or in-app purchases
- Limited cultural context or deep linguistic explanations
- Might become repetitive over time without supplementary resources
